Octavia Butler's groundbreaking novel follows Dana, a Black woman living in 1970s California who is inexplicably transported back to a pre-Civil War Maryland plantation. Forced to navigate the brutal realities of slavery to ensure her own survival, Dana confronts the horrifying legacy of American slavery while grappling with questions of identity, power, and the complex connections between past and present. A powerful blend of science fiction, historical fiction, and social commentary that remains urgently relevant.
WHY WE PICKED IT: Because Butler doesn't just write about history—she forces readers to viscerally experience it. Kindred is a profound exploration of how the past continues to shape the present, challenging readers to confront the ongoing impact of slavery and systemic racism with unflinching honesty.
